The Telephone Tank can be found on the Telephone Canyon USGS quad topo map. Telephone Tank is a reservoir in Catron County in the state of New Mexico. The latitude and longitude coordinates for this reservoir are 33.5651, -108.5603 and the altitude is 7730 feet (2356 meters).
